A physically-based model for the simulation of reactive turbulent objects
Résumé
The challenging issue that is addressed here is the modeling of turbulent phenomena, physically consistent, and reactive at the same time. The aim is, first, to understand these phenomena in order to elaborate a particle-bases dynamic model, capable of accounting for a certain number of experimentally observed recognizable turbulent phenomena (consistençy). Next, the aim is to achieve not only beautiful shapes, not only the fine dynamics slow and fleeting of turbulent objects left to themselves, but the still richer movements that result from the interaction with man (reactivity).
